What's Actually Going On at This Age

Most puppy problems aren't training problems. They're communication problems. Your puppy isn't trying to be "bad." They're trying to figure out a world they don't understand yet — and they're learning every minute of every day whether you're teaching them or not. The piddle on the floor, the biting, the barking at the door, the chewing — every one of those is a puppy looking for information about how this house works. We give them that information in a way they can actually receive it. Calm. Clear. Consistent. From the first session.

Why In-Home Matters for a Puppy

A puppy class teaches your puppy how to behave in a puppy class. That's not where the problems are. The problems are in your kitchen. At your front door. On your couch. In your backyard. We come to where the behaviour is actually happening, work the dog where the dog is going to live, and leave you with skills that work in your real life — not in a rented gymnasium full of treats.
